Output 94c69e763553738897cc1a6796bbc66ce4ecc207bd6b5d8ce03428ea86bc187e:0

value
8713413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e62ef77b34ce1034aff6ee340c987a01af5b86 OP_EQUAL
address
3Ke87a1c6DDHA6EjKNhkrNZbZamRkRVSK8
transaction
94c69e763553738897cc1a6796bbc66ce4ecc207bd6b5d8ce03428ea86bc187e
confirmations
191488
spent
true